Transaction 52dfc30283a5eaf98f798c6cfd5a18caad70767c294fe9114e1c0b30142acc31

21 Input
2 Outputs
  • 52dfc30283a5eaf98f798c6cfd5a18caad70767c294fe9114e1c0b30142acc31:0
  • value  987893
    address  32DLwenxuu8MFEkoKFyDXxKwy3Fdq42gpQ
  • 52dfc30283a5eaf98f798c6cfd5a18caad70767c294fe9114e1c0b30142acc31:1
  • value  1360406939
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s